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ym SNDA is...

SNDA is

  • Shanda Interactive Entertainment Ltd.

More Meanings For SNDA:

  • Shanda Interactive Entertainment Ltd.
  • supplemental new drug application

SNDA is also in:

Acronym Definition Searched: 47110 CIE PPT DODGE WNUY 27150 SVO PPCP MDRQ KMFDM SSRI BHAF 91603 NFL 27526